Crusaders Win the Heavyweight Battle, Take Down No 5 Mid Valley

Crusaders Win the Heavyweight Battle, Take Down No 5 Mid Valley

By: Justin Bradley | SportzWire | May 7, 2026 | Photo courtesy Justin Focus

Holy Cross Varsity Crusaders defeated Mid Valley 5-2 on Thursday, largely thanks to a dominant pitching performance from Ava Schmidt. Schmidt carved through the Mid Valley lineup, recording 13 strikeouts over seven innings. She allowed just four hits and two runs while issuing two walks.

Offensively, Peyton Graboske led the way for Holy Cross, going three for three at the plate. Graboske hit a solo home run to center field in the fourth inning, doubled in the seventh, and singled in the fifth, showcasing her versatility.

Mid Valley got on the scoreboard first in the third inning when Julie Prisco hit a triple, driving in one run to take an early lead.

Holy Cross responded in the top of the fourth, tying the game at one with Peyton Graboske's solo home run. The Crusaders then took control in the fifth inning as Jules Galella launched a home run to center field, giving her team a 4-1 advantage.

Mid Valley attempted a comeback in the sixth inning when Ariana Davey hit a solo home run to left field, bringing the score to 4-2.

Ava Hazelton took the loss for Mid Valley. She pitched a complete game, allowing five runs on seven hits, striking out 11 batters, and walking seven.

Jules Galella was a key run producer for Holy Cross, leading the team with three runs batted in, going one for four on the day. Ava Schmidt also contributed at the plate, collecting two hits in four at bats. Holy Cross demonstrated patience throughout the game, drawing a total of seven walks, with McKinley Griffiths and Emily Fitzpatrick each earning two free passes.

For Mid Valley, Ariana Davey led the offense with one run batted in, finishing two for three at the plate. The Mid Valley defense played a clean game, not committing any errors, and turned one double play. Ariana Davey was busy behind the plate, handling 11 chances in the field.
